Part 2, Chapters 11-13Chapter Summaries & Analyses

Part 2, Chapter 11 Summary

The next day, Ben and Susan visit Matt in his hospital room. Matt is better but still weak. Since Mike is unable to leave the hospital, he will handle vampire research. The next step is for Susan and Ben to talk to Doctor Jimmy Cody, who examined both Mike Ryerson and Floyd Tibbits, so he may be poised to believe. They need to recruit Father Callahan as well. Susan asks why they do not go to the Marsten House as they had planned to do in the first place, but the situation has changed with Matt’s heart attack. Ben and Matt have decided to proceed on the assumption that vampires are real. The last thing they want to do is alert Barlow and Straker that someone is onto them.

When Ben and Susan go to speak with Doctor Cody, Cody tells them someone snatched all the bodies from the county morgue in Portland. Ben and Susan tell him their story, and Cody thinks it over. Finally, he tells them there are so many things still unknown that medical science is hardly more than white magic.

Cody lays out a plan to examine the bodies of the suspected vampire victims.
